2016-08-21 33 views
1

我使用React Native內置的跨平臺自定義字體支持,在我的項目中使用自定義字體。我很好奇,是否有將fontFamily應用於ToolbarAndroid組件(https://facebook.github.io/react-native/docs/toolbarandroid.html)。不幸的是,工具欄style不支持密鑰。React-Native ToolbarAndroid不支持fontFamily

我也試圖設置標題組件myTitle並將其進料工具欄title屬性,但是這會導致循環錯誤:

var myTitle = <Text style={{fontFamily: 'MyFont'}}>My Profile</Text> 

理想情況下,我很想保持原生工具欄,而不是更換它具有支持自定義字體的自定義JS工具欄。

回答

4

通過將mytitle組件,使用自定義fontFamily,該ToolbarAndroid標籤內,像這樣修正:

<ToolbarAndroid>{mytitle}</ToolbarAndroid> 

而不是試圖把ToolbarAndroid的title屬性中的組件。

+0

太棒了!感謝您花時間發佈您如何解決此問題:)您應將此標記爲答案。 – robinmitra